Bejeweled 3 drops a gem on us December 7

Just when you thought you were ready to kick that decade-old "habit," PopCap goes and announces Bejeweled 3. You might be thinking: Okay, so they just added the number three to the title ... I can resist that. Really? Can you?

The only good news is you don't have to lie to yourself, because it's not just the number three that's been added. The new Bejeweled -- coming in, uh-oh, just five short weeks -- appears to offer plenty of excuses for your imminent relapse, including new Quest and Zen modes, plus unlockable "secret" game variants. Of course, you can always blame it on the "ultra-smooth gameplay" and "mellifluous music and sound" -- that's probably even grounds for a class action right there.

Beginning December 7, Bejeweled 3 will be peddled for $20 through online and retail outlets across North America, Europe and Asia. A Popcap representative confirmed to Joystiq that at that time the game will be available for PC and Mac, with other unannounced platforms to follow.

PopCap Games Announces Bejeweled® 3

Long-Anticipated Sequel to World's Most Popular Puzzle Game Will Take Match-3 Genre to New Heights


SEATTLE, Washington, and DUBLIN, Ireland – November 1, 2010 - PopCap Games, the worldwide leader in casual games, today announced the imminent launch of Bejeweled® 3, the first true sequel to its beloved flagship franchise in more than six years. Featuring a wealth of new content and triple the fun of previous installments in the series, Bejeweled 3 elevates the "match-3" category of puzzle games pioneered by PopCap a decade ago to an entirely new level. Bejeweled 3 will launch on December 7, 2010 via PopCap.com and other major portals in North America, Europe and Asia Pacific as well as at leading retail outlets throughout North America at a suggested retail price of US$19.95.

Beyond stunning, high-definition graphics and mellifluous music and sound effects, Bejeweled 3 is packed with completely new game experiences in addition to updated and expanded re-imaginings of the four original game modes from Bejeweled 2. Four all-new secret games including Ice Storm and Poker offer surprising new interpretations of the Bejeweled theme, while Quest mode features eleven mini-games - clever hybrids of Bejeweled game-play with other classic game mechanics - comprising 40 total quests.

New and expanded features in Bejeweled 3 will include:

- Classic: Play the most popular puzzle game of the century, with powerful new gems and new ultra-smooth gameplay

- Quest: Journey through 40 magical puzzles in this multifaceted Bejeweled challenge!

- Zen: Personalize your experience with ambient sounds and binaural beats - a revolutionary new way to relax!

- Lightning: Charge up with a heart-pounding, beat-the-clock bout of gem-blasting fun!

- Secret Games: Unlock 4 all-new games including Butterflies and Ice Storm

- Badges: Earn up to 65 badges to prove your skills

- High-definition graphics and high-fidelity audio: Bejeweled is now more dazzling than ever before!

- Ultra-smooth gameplay: Make multiple matches while new gems fall into place

Since its introduction 10 years ago, Bejeweled has become one of the top 10 video game franchises in history. More than half a billion people worldwide have played the game, and over 50 million units have been sold across 17 platforms. An estimated 7.5 billion hours have been spent playing Bejeweled, and the game continues to sell at the rate of one copy every 4.3 seconds.
